Registriert seit: 27. Aug 2010
47 Beiträge
|
AW: Datei mit FileStream auslesen
27. Aug 2010, 11:14
Hi DeddyH,
ne, hat nicht geholfen. Der Zeiger wird doch aber nicht verändert, wenn ich die Datei nur hintereinander auslese, oder ? Und wie gesagt, die Datei wird ja auch richtig ausgelesen.
Die Fehlermeldung kommt erst beim Beenden des Programms , also der xxx.exe.
Es sieht ja fast so aus, als ob dann beim Programmbeenden eine unzulässige Adresse angesprochen wird. Aber wieso ?
Gibt es eigentlich noch andere Möglichkeiten außer mit TFileStream, derartige Dateien auszulesen ? Den Dateien kann man auch keine konstante Struktur zuordnen, sodass man mit records hätte arbeiten können.
Das Problem dabei ist ja, dass die Dateilänge nie gleich ist, abhängig davon z.B. wie lang Kommentare sind oder wieviele Datenkanäle abgespeichert wurden. Diese Angaben finde ich immer erst direkt in der Datei, aber das funktioniert ja auch richtig. Nur eben das Ende...
Vielen Dank
|